About this Event

Kingston Council and Kingston University (KU), in partnership with Kingston Chamber of Commerce, invites all businesses in and around the borough, and local residents, to join our event on circular and regenerative economy.

Building on previous Think Green discussions, academic research and successful local case studies, we are bringing together at the Town House, businesses, academics, policy makers, students and residents to show the triple positive impact of shifting to a circular economy: on businesses, the consumers and the planet. The Earth’s resources are limited, the population is growing and commodity prices have increased considerably over the last 20 years. The environmental and financial costs of disposing of waste are substantial.

The solution is to move from our linear ‘take-make-dispose’ economic model, to a circular economy. An economy where waste is eliminated; a zero-waste, regenerative economy.

Exhibitors:


  • Cardo Group: Trialling new and innovative partnerships with local micro businesses to resell furniture destined for landfill.
  • Just Clear: A sustainable, award-winning, clearance service, committed to ensuring as many items as possible are reused and recycled locally in a transparent way.
  • KAPDAA: A 360 degree solution for the borough's garment waste.
  • Relove Technology Limited: Supporting local businesses to sign up to the Government's IT 'Reuse for Good Charter' and helping to close the digital divide in our communities.
  • Save The World Club: Promoting "The Circulatory" warehouse, which is a circular economy hub along with their offer to the public, public sector, charitable sector and business sector in Kingston upon Thames.
  • Veolia in Partnership with Kingston Council: Showcasing green careers and helping people to recycle more and waste less.
